Design & Build: Luxury Meets Durability

The Honor Magic 5 Pro features a curved OLED display that gives it a fluid, modern look. The back panel uses premium materials and the phone feels incredibly sturdy in hand. Plus, it’s IP68-rated for water and dust resistance—a big win for outdoor lovers.

Display Brilliance: OLED at Its Finest

You get a 6.81-inch LTPO OLED screen with a 120Hz refresh rate. Translation? Ultra-smooth scrolling, vibrant colors, and peak brightness that outshines most competitors. Geekzilla.tech highlights this display as one of the best in class, perfect for gamers and Netflix bingers.

Camera System: It’s Basically a DSLR

If photography is your jam, the Honor Magic 5 Pro won’t disappoint. It rocks a triple-lens setup:

  • 50MP Wide lens
  • 50MP Ultra-wide
  • 50MP Periscope telephoto

With AI-enhanced night mode and 100x digital zoom, this phone doesn’t just capture moments—it elevates them.

Performance: Fast, Fluid, Fearless

Powered by the Snapdragon 8 Gen 2 chipset, coupled with up to 12GB RAM, this device handles multitasking like a beast. Whether you’re gaming, video editing, or running heavy apps, lag isn’t a concern.

Battery Life: Long-lasting and Smart

With a 5100mAh battery, it easily lasts over a day. And thanks to 66W wired + 50W wireless charging, your phone is ready to roll in minutes. Geekzilla.tech praised the smart charging optimization that extends battery lifespan.

MagicOS: A Customized Android Experience

Running on MagicOS 7.1 based on Android 13, the interface feels fluid and clean. No bloatware, just thoughtful additions like gesture controls, smart folder management, and productivity tools.

Security Features

With both an under-display fingerprint scanner and advanced 3D facial recognition, the Magic 5 Pro is secure yet convenient. You can bank, shop, and browse without worry.

5G & Connectivity

Yes, it’s future-ready. From dual 5G support to Wi-Fi 6E and NFC, you’re all set for high-speed internet and seamless sharing.

FAQs

1. Is the Honor Magic 5 Pro better than the Samsung Galaxy S23 Ultra?

It depends on what you value. The Magic 5 Pro excels in camera flexibility and fast charging, while Samsung offers a more refined software ecosystem.

2. Does it support wireless charging?

Yes! It supports 50W wireless charging, which is among the fastest on the market.

3. Is the phone good for gaming?

Absolutely. With the Snapdragon 8 Gen 2, high refresh rate OLED display, and vapor chamber cooling system, it’s built for intense gaming sessions.

4. Can it survive water splashes or accidental drops?

Yes, it’s IP68-rated, making it resistant to dust and water immersion up to 1.5 meters for 30 minutes.
